SSO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review

208 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in ProShares Ultra S&P500 (SSO)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$924M — down 27% from $1.27B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 44 funds opened new SSO positions and 37 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 50 added to existing stakes and 64 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Howard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$156M. The largest seller was AssetMark Inc, cutting an estimated $559M.
